Ceramic tile repl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ated tiles and installing new ones to restore the appearance and functionality of floors, walls, or countertops. This process typically starts with carefully removing the existing tiles without causing damage to the underlying surface. Once the area is prepped, the new ceramic tiles are precisely laid, grouted, and sealed to ensure a durable and attractive finish. These services help homeowners update the look of k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, or any space where ceramic tiles are used, providing a fresh, modern appearance.
This type of service is often sought when existing tiles become cracked, chipped, stained, or loose over time. Damage can occur from heavy impacts, water infiltration, or general wear and tear, making replacement necessary to prevent further issues such as water damage or mold growth. Additionally, ceramic tile replacement can be part of a larger renovation project aimed at modernizing a property’s interior or fixing aesthetic flaws that no longer match the homeowner’s style. Service providers can also assist with matching new tiles to existing ones for seamless repairs or replacing entire sections for a uniform look.

The overview below groups typical Ceramic Tiles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Warrenton,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tile replacements or repairs in Warrenton, MO range from $250 to $600. Most rout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like fixing cracked tiles or replacing a few damaged pieces.
Standard Replacement - Replacing tiles across a kitchen or bathroom area us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Local contractors often see many projects in this middle range, depending on the size and tile materials used.
Full Room Renovation - Complete tile replacement for an entire room can range from $3,500 to $8,000. Larger, more detailed projects with premium materials tend to push into higher tiers, though many projects stay within the mid-range.
Large-Scale or Complex Projects - Extensive tile work, such as multiple rooms or custom designs, can exceed $8,000 and reach $15,000+ in some cases. These higher costs are less common but are typical for highly customized or intricate installations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
